
   English French
Google | Forvo | +
storm water
 storm water
nat.res. eau de pluie
| channel
construct. pièces pour caniveaux
earth.sc. mech.eng. trou d'équilibrage
industr. construct. gravure
tech. bras de mer; canal; chenal; filet d'eau; passage
transp. industr. construct. gravurer

to phrases
storm water
nat.res. eau de pluie
storm water: 54 phrases in 8 subjects
Life sciences1
Mechanic engineering1
Municipal planning2
Natural resourses and wildlife conservation18
United Nations1
Water resources2